diff options
Diffstat (limited to 'games/wmpuzzle/files')
-rw-r--r-- | games/wmpuzzle/files/patch-Makefile | 61 | ||||
-rw-r--r-- | games/wmpuzzle/files/patch-wmpuzzle.6 | 14 | ||||
-rw-r--r-- | games/wmpuzzle/files/patch-wmpuzzle.c | 30 |
3 files changed, 105 insertions, 0 deletions
diff --git a/games/wmpuzzle/files/patch-Makefile b/games/wmpuzzle/files/patch-Makefile new file mode 100644 index 000000000000..b5f77e78a1eb --- /dev/null +++ b/games/wmpuzzle/files/patch-Makefile @@ -0,0 +1,61 @@ +$FreeBSD$ + +--- Makefile.orig Wed Mar 13 23:09:33 2002 ++++ Makefile Wed May 15 20:32:38 2002 +@@ -1,45 +1,18 @@ +-# $Id: Makefile,v 1.11 2002/03/13 17:09:33 godisch Exp $ ++CC ?= gcc ++CFLAGS += -c -Wall -pedantic ++INCDIR = -I${X11BASE}/include -I/usr/local/include ++LIBDIR = -L${X11BASE}/lib -L/usr/local/lib ++LIBS = -lXpm -lXext -lX11 -lgnugetopt ++OBJS = wmpuzzle.o wmgeneral.o + +-prefix = /usr/local +-exec_prefix = ${prefix} +-bindir = ${exec_prefix}/bin +-mandir = ${prefix}/share/man ++.c.o: ++ ${CC} ${CFLAGS} ${INCDIR} $< -o $*.o + +-DESTDIR = +- +-CFLAGS = -O2 -Wall -pedantic +-LIBS = -L/usr/X11R6/lib -lX11 -lXpm -lXext +-XPMS = xpm/debian.xpm xpm/eagle.xpm xpm/earth.xpm xpm/linux.xpm ++wmpuzzle: $(OBJS) ++ ${CC} -o wmpuzzle $^ ${LIBDIR} ${LIBS} + + all: wmpuzzle + +-wmpuzzle: wmpuzzle.o wmgeneral.o +- $(CC) $(LIBS) -o $@ $^ +- +-wmpuzzle.o: wmpuzzle.c wmpuzzle.h $(XPMS) +-wmgeneral.o: wmgeneral.c wmgeneral.h +- +-install: install-bin install-doc +- +-install-bin: wmpuzzle +- install -D -s -m 755 $< $(DESTDIR)$(bindir)/wmpuzzle +- +-install-doc: wmpuzzle.6 +- install -D -m 644 $< $(DESTDIR)$(mandir)/man6/wmpuzzle.6 +- +-uninstall: uninstall-bin uninstall-doc +- +-uninstall-bin: +- rm -f $(DESTDIR)$(bindir)/wmpuzzle +- +-uninstall-doc: +- rm -f $(DESTDIR)$(mandir)/man6/wmpuzzle.6 +- + clean: + rm -f *.o +- +-distclean: clean +- rm -f wmpuzzle +- +-.PHONY: all clean dist-clean install install-bin install-doc \ +- uninstall uninstall-bin uninstall-doc ++ rm -f wmpuzzle core diff --git a/games/wmpuzzle/files/patch-wmpuzzle.6 b/games/wmpuzzle/files/patch-wmpuzzle.6 new file mode 100644 index 000000000000..ced79ca91983 --- /dev/null +++ b/games/wmpuzzle/files/patch-wmpuzzle.6 @@ -0,0 +1,14 @@ +$FreeBSD$ + +--- wmpuzzle.6.orig Wed Mar 13 23:09:33 2002 ++++ wmpuzzle.6 Wed May 15 21:22:41 2002 +@@ -26,7 +26,8 @@ + .TP + \fB\-i\fP, \fB\-\-image=\fIimage\fP + the image which shall be shown. +-Valid images are \fIdebian\fP, \fIeagle\fP, \fIearth\fP, and \fIlinux\fP. ++Valid images are \fIdebian\fP, \fIeagle\fP, \fIearth\fP, \fIlinux\fP, ++and \fIdaemon\fP. + Other images will be included on request. + .TP + \fB\-k\fP, \fB\-\-keyboard\fP diff --git a/games/wmpuzzle/files/patch-wmpuzzle.c b/games/wmpuzzle/files/patch-wmpuzzle.c new file mode 100644 index 000000000000..e5afbe286733 --- /dev/null +++ b/games/wmpuzzle/files/patch-wmpuzzle.c @@ -0,0 +1,30 @@ +$FreeBSD$ + +--- wmpuzzle.c.orig Thu Apr 18 00:13:52 2002 ++++ wmpuzzle.c Wed May 15 21:21:20 2002 +@@ -22,6 +22,7 @@ + #include "xpm/eagle.xpm" + #include "xpm/earth.xpm" + #include "xpm/linux.xpm" ++#include "xpm/daemon.xpm" + + #define PROGRAM_NAME "wmpuzzle" + #define PROGRAM_VERSION "0.1.1" +@@ -203,6 +204,8 @@ + *wmpuzzle = earth_xpm; + else if (!strcmp(optarg, "linux")) + *wmpuzzle = linux_xpm; ++ else if (!strcmp(optarg, "daemon")) ++ *wmpuzzle = daemon_xpm; + else { + fprintf(stderr, "%s: invalid image `%s'\n", PROGRAM_NAME, optarg); + exit(1); +@@ -224,7 +227,7 @@ + printf("Usage: %s [-h] [-i <image>] [-k] [-s <count>] [-v]\n", PROGRAM_NAME); + printf(" -h, --help displays this command line summary.\n"); + printf(" -i, --image <image> uses <image>, valid images are `debian', `eagle',\n"); +- printf(" `earth', and `linux'.\n"); ++ printf(" `earth', `linux', and `daemon'.\n"); + printf(" -k, --keyboard enables the arrow keys on the keyboard.\n"); + printf(" -s, --shuffle <count> shuffles the image <count> times.\n"); + printf(" -v, --version displays the version number.\n"); |